What is Stainless Steel 304L?
Stainless Steel 304L is a low-carbon version of Stainless Steel 304, designed to enhance welding and other fabrication processes. The "L" in 304L stands for "low carbon," signifying its carbon content is limited to 0.03%. This feature reduces the risk of carbide precipitation during welding, ensuring excellent corrosion resistance.
Chemical Composition:
• Chromium (Cr): 18-20%
• Nickel (Ni): 8-12%
• Carbon (C): ≤ 0.03%
• Manganese (Mn): ≤ 2.0%
• Silicon (Si): ≤ 1.0%
• Phosphorus (P): ≤ 0.045%
• Sulfur (S): ≤ 0.03%
Conclusion
Stainless Steel 304L coils are a versatile, durable, and corrosion-resistant material suitable for diverse applications. Their low carbon content makes them ideal for welding and other fabrication processes, while their excellent mechanical and aesthetic properties ensure they meet the needs of various industries. Proper maintenance can further enhance their lifespan, making them a cost-effective choice for long-term projects.
